Searched refs:cur_thread (Results 1 - 11 of 11) sorted by relevance

/xnu-2422.115.4/osfmk/kperf/
H A Dcontext.h34 thread_t cur_thread; member in struct:kperf_context
H A Dthreadinfo.c77 thread_t cur_thread = context->cur_thread; local
78 BUF_INFO1( PERF_TI_SAMPLE, (uintptr_t)cur_thread );
82 ti->tid = thread_tid(cur_thread);
83 ti->dq_addr = thread_dispatchqaddr(cur_thread);
84 ti->runmode = make_runmode(cur_thread);
101 thread_t cur_thread = context->cur_thread; local
107 if( cur_thread != chudxnu_current_thread() )
112 t_chud = kperf_get_thread_bits(cur_thread);
[all...]
H A Dcallstack.c56 BUF_INFO1( code, (uintptr_t)context->cur_thread );
74 kr = chudxnu_thread_get_callstack64_kperf( context->cur_thread,
162 return kperf_ast_pend( context->cur_thread, T_AST_CALLSTACK,
H A Daction.c252 ctx.cur_thread = thread;
279 kperf_ast_pend( thread_t cur_thread, uint32_t check_bits, argument
286 if( cur_thread != chudxnu_current_thread() )
290 t_chud = kperf_get_thread_bits(cur_thread);
297 kperf_set_thread_bits(cur_thread, t_chud);
300 kperf_set_thread_ast( cur_thread );
307 // BUF_INFO3( dbg_code, (uintptr_t)cur_thread, t_chud, set_done );
368 ctx.cur_thread = thread;
H A Dtimetrigger.c116 ctx.cur_thread = current_thread();
118 task = chudxnu_task_for_thread(ctx.cur_thread);
128 kperf_thread_on_cpus[ncpu] = ctx.cur_thread;
H A Dpet.c72 ctx.cur_thread = thread;
/xnu-2422.115.4/osfmk/kern/
H A Dkpc_common.c242 ctx.cur_thread = current_thread();
244 task = chudxnu_task_for_thread(ctx.cur_thread);
H A Dthread.c1870 thread_t cur_thread; local
1874 cur_thread = current_thread();
1875 funnel_state_prev = ((cur_thread->funnel_state & TH_FN_OWNED) == TH_FN_OWNED);
1881 if (cur_thread->funnel_lock)
1882 panic("Funnel lock called when holding one %p", cur_thread->funnel_lock);
1888 cur_thread->funnel_state |= TH_FN_OWNED;
1889 cur_thread->funnel_lock = fnl;
1891 if(cur_thread->funnel_lock->fnl_mutex != fnl->fnl_mutex)
1893 cur_thread->funnel_state &= ~TH_FN_OWNED;
1897 cur_thread
[all...]
H A Dtelemetry.c357 ctx.cur_thread = thread;
/xnu-2422.115.4/osfmk/ipc/
H A Dipc_mqueue.c387 thread_t cur_thread = current_thread(); local
404 thread_lock(cur_thread);
415 cur_thread);
416 thread_unlock(cur_thread);
/xnu-2422.115.4/osfmk/vm/
H A Dvm_map.c4119 thread_t cur_thread; local
4140 cur_thread = current_thread();
4496 if (!user_wire && cur_thread != THREAD_NULL)
4509 if (!user_wire && cur_thread != THREAD_NULL)

Completed in 113 milliseconds